Typical Mistakes to Prevent During Gutter Setup for Durable Outcomes



Reliable seamless gutter installation is important for making certain the durability and capability of a home's drainage system. Concerns such as overestimating gutter size, disregarding appropriate slope, and inappropriate downspout positioning can have considerable effects. Cleveland Roofing Solutions.


Miscalculating Seamless Gutter Dimension



When setting up seamless gutters, miscalculating gutter size can cause significant concerns, consisting of water damages and increased maintenance prices. The key feature of seamless gutters is to properly direct rainwater away from a structure's foundation. If rain gutters are undersized, they can overflow during heavy rains, leading to water merging around the structure and potentially causing structural damage. Conversely, large rain gutters may be unneeded and can produce aesthetic inequalities, while also enhancing the price of products and setup.


To avoid these risks, it is critical to examine the particular demands of the residential or commercial property based on elements such as roofing system size, pitch, and neighborhood rains patterns. Determining the appropriate gutter size includes recognizing the quantity of water that the roofing system will certainly gather and ensuring the rain gutter system can suit it. Utilizing market standards and standards can assist in identifying the appropriate dimensions for the gutters required.


Additionally, seeking advice from specialists that have experience in gutter installment can aid and offer useful understandings make certain the correct computations are made. Eventually, taking the time to accurately gauge and pick the ideal seamless gutter dimension will certainly generate long-lasting advantages and secure versus prospective water-related issues.

Neglecting Appropriate Slope



Correct incline is necessary for an efficient rain gutter system, as it directly influences water drain performance. A well-designed rain gutter must have a minor slope, typically around 1/4 inch for every single 10 feet of length, routing water towards the downspouts. Failing to develop this slope can cause water pooling in sections of the rain gutter, increasing the threat of overflow, clogs, and eventual damage to the framework.


Furthermore, improper incline can aggravate damage on the rain gutter products, bring about early failure and expensive repairs. Property owners may find that water waterfalls over the edge during heavy rainfall, developing potential hazards around the structure and landscaping. Furthermore, stagnant water can become a breeding ground for bugs and might motivate mold growth.

To guarantee appropriate installation, it is recommended to make use of a level throughout the process. This focus to detail not only boosts capability but also adds to the durability of the gutter system. By prioritizing the proper slope, property owners can protect their property versus water-related issues and minimize maintenance requirements with time.


Skipping Wall Mounts and assistances





A sturdy rain gutter system relies heavily on making use of wall mounts and supports, which are important for maintaining architectural integrity and reliable water flow. Overlooking these components can bring about drooping gutters, resulting in inappropriate drain and potential water damages to your home.




Supports and hangers have to be mounted at proper periods, usually every a couple of feet, depending upon the rain gutter size and product. This ensures that the weight of the water, particles, and ice does not endanger the gutter's functionality. Missing these important components can produce anxiety points in the system, causing leaks and premature wear.


In addition, the option of products see this website for wall mounts and assistances need to not be overlooked. Selecting long lasting, corrosion-resistant products will improve the longevity of the rain gutter system. Plastic may seem cost-efficient however can damage with time, while metal sustains offer improved strength and strength.

Overlooking Downspout Placement



Effective downspout positioning is an essential element of rain gutter installment that is often forgotten, yet it plays a substantial role in making sure optimum drainage. Correctly positioned downspouts direct water far from the structure of the home, avoiding prospective water damages or disintegration. An usual blunder is to set up downspouts also close to the foundation, which can lead to water merging and boosted risk of architectural problems.


Furthermore, the number and area of downspouts must be strategically prepared based on the additional info roofing dimension and slope. Inadequate downspout placement can cause gutters to overflow throughout heavy rainfall, bring about water cascading over the sides and possibly harmful landscape design or house siding - Cleveland Roofing Solutions. It is a good idea to position downspouts at periods that permit for ample water circulation, commonly every 30 to 40 feet of gutter length


In addition, consider the terrain bordering the home. Downspouts ought to be guided in the direction of drainage systems or find out this here away from your house to enhance water flow efficiency. In summary, meticulous planning of downspout positioning is necessary for efficient water management and the lasting sturdiness of the rain gutter system. Correct placement ensures that water is efficiently carried away, protecting the stability of the residential property.


Disregarding Securing and Maintenance



While numerous homeowners focus on the first installation of their seamless gutters, overlooking securing and upkeep can lead to significant lasting concerns. Over time, the seams and joints of rain gutters can weaken, especially if not properly secured.


Particles such as branches and fallen leaves can collect in gutters, blocking water flow. Normal cleansing and evaluation of gutters guarantee that they operate effectively, expanding their life-span and preserving their performance.


Additionally, property owners should think about using sealer to joints every year, specifically in regions vulnerable to severe weather condition conditions. This aggressive technique decreases the danger of leakages and boosts the rain gutter system's sturdiness. By prioritizing sealing and upkeep, homeowners can avoid pricey repair services and protect the honesty of their homes, ultimately causing an extra long-lasting and reliable gutter system.
